Just wondering if anyone else here thinks or has an issue with the direct injection pump being noisy when cold. It quiets down after a bit of driving but never completely goes away. There is actually a noise cover on the pump in the engine compartment but I still think it is louder than any other injection pump I have heard on a Ford. My wife says it sounds like a Vespa when it's cold and I have to agree. That's probably the best description I could compare it to.

Its normal with the noise and Ford has a bulletin. There is a cover on the pump. On the Lariat there was(key word) an engine cover that also helped dampen the noise. The Lariat doesnt come with it anymore for who knows what reason but if you buy one it will help with noise.
